Только, опять же, Issue
без минимального кода закрываются (мои, по крайней мере). Даже если бы у меня и была возможность их писать. Однако, опять же, было одно исключение из правил, и оно до сих пор висит на GitHub
. Если было сделано исключение - то возникают соответственно вопрос: Почему именно в этом случае? Повторюсь, что сделав исключение легче гораздо сделать его ещё раз и ещё раз. Зачем оно было сделано, если здесь некому заниматься поиском минимального кода? Тестировщиков даже нет. Правила должны быть одни для всех. И пусть, та Issue
до сих пор открыта, но она открыта, а не закрыта, от нее не «избавились» по-быстрому, потому что не было краткого кода для воспроизведения ошибки. Пользователям нужно чётко знать когда такое позволительно. Если никогда, то той Issue
не место среди открытых.
Когда то у Вас тоже звучали те же слова - «мы Вам ничего не должны». И я с ними согласен - проект держится на чистом энтузиазме. Ровно также поступаем и мы, но когда это делаем мы, почему-то активные участники форума воспринимают это в штыки. Будто мы им что-то обязаны и на них работаем. Мы говорим это открыто, потому что нам нечего скрывать. У нас нет времени специально для PascalABC.NET, чтобы заниматься его тестированием. Мы Вас не обязывали исправлять ошибку, мы не писали, что «Вы должны», тем более со сроками. Мы о ней сказали и потому что она была на Вашей стороне. Нет, вместо «спасибо», получили множество негатива со стороны участников Вашего форума. Это неправильно. Согласитесь, то, что у Вас малая команда - Ваша проблема и странно злиться на нас, что мы Вам не помогаем тестированием, если особенно учесть, что мы такой же проект как и Ваш, в некотором смысле. На счет «давности ошибки» - хорошо, что выяснилось, что её больше нет, но плохо то, что об этом нельзя узнать по официальному сайту. Как понять можно было, что «ошибка исправлена - можно обновляться»? Никак. Здесь - проблема проинформированности пользователя об изменениях. И это - уже по части команды проекта PascalABC.NET. Так что претензии в стиле «Вы не обновились» в каком-то смысле вина Вашей команды. Мы не обновляемся «на каждый чих». Так со всем, не только с PascalABC.NET.
- «Мы Вам ничего не должны, но Вы нам должны.» - ситуация с PascalABC.NET.
- «Мы Вам должны, но Вы нам не должны ничего.» - наша позиция.
И такая позиция проекта PascalABC.NET в большей степени обеспечивается не самими разработчиками, а активными участниками форума. Разработчикам остаётся только их поддержать. Представьте, что Ваше сообщество, которое количественно больше команды разработчиков имеет такую как мы позицию - многое бы было по-другому. Такое будет продолжаться, пока каждый не изменится. Сам, по своей воле, в лучшую сторону. Ведь, мы берём пример часто с тех, с кем общаемся. Изменитесь Вы - изменится коллектив, ибо Вы в нём лидер. Стая (не в обиду будет сказано) идёт за своим вожаком…